Motorstorm: Pacifc Rift demo UPDATED

... is availible from September 12th - if you have downloaded Qore, september episode.

You will be able to play single player and spilt-screen multiplayer, no online play though.
The track in the demo is named Rain God Spires, the sequel to Rain God Mesa of the original Motorstorm. The track is "an Air Zone track that takes you along a bumpy coastal mountain circuit with plenty of ups and downs to highlight the game's massive draw distance".

UPDATE: My toughts after trying the demo is that it's rather more of an expansion of Motorstorm than a sequel.
If you look at other sequels they improve gameplay, graphics, add more content and perhaps new game modes (and of course work on the story if it's a story based game).

Altough this is just a demo you can tell that there isn't much new besides a few new vehicles and the new tracks. The track in the demo looks good, but compared to Motorstorm, the landscape in the distance is really the most noticable thing that is improved in Motorstorm: Pacific Rift.

So, all in all, it's good. But not the WOW we were hoping for. So Motorstorm: Pacific Rift just fell a few places down on my "to get" list.
